Washington forward Antawn Jamison practiced without a protective sleeve on his banged-up right knee on Monday and expects to be at 100 percent for the start of the regular season.

"No pain at all. No stiffness or anything like that," Jamison said after practice. "I feel pretty good."

He bruised the knee and left in the first quarter of the team's first preseason game on Oct. 7.

"I'm glad that everything worked out pretty well, and it wasn't as severe as they thought it was going to be," Jamison said. "No lingering effects."
